The Condensation Crisis: A Case Study in Accountability
I recall a homeowner in a high-rise who called me in a panic because their brand-new, expensive double-pane units were ‘sweating’ on the interior glass surface every morning. The original installation team had told them the windows were ‘too airtight’ and they needed to run a dehumidifier. I walked in with my hygrometer and a laser thermometer. I showed them that while the room humidity was a reasonable 35 percent, the glass temperature at the glazing bead was dropping below the dew point. The issue wasn’t the lifestyle; it was a failure in the warm-edge spacer system that the provider had incorrectly specified for our northern climate. I armed that homeowner with the thermal data, and only then did the provider agree to a full sash replacement. This is why local experts are vital; they understand that in cold climates, the U-Factor and the Condensation Resistance (CR) rating are the only metrics that matter when the mercury hits zero.

The Anatomy of an Installation Failure
When a provider makes a mistake, it usually happens in the rough opening. To get them to own it, you need to understand the ‘Shingle Principle’ of water management. Water must always be directed out and down. If a technician installed the flashing tape in the wrong order, with the side flashing overlapping the top header flashing, they have created a ‘reverse lap’ that funnels water behind the sash and into your wall cavity. If you see rot on your drywall, do not let them tell you it is a roof leak. Demand they pull the exterior trim. If you see bare wood without a sill pan, you have found the smoking gun. A proper sill pan is a three-sided enclosure that catches any water that gets past the primary seals and directs it back out through weep holes.
The Physics of Heat Loss and Support Recovery
In our northern latitudes, the primary enemy is heat loss via conduction and radiation. A provider might try to blame ‘thermal bridging’ on your house’s framing, but the truth often lies in the shim placement. If they used wood shims and failed to insulate the gap between the window frame and the rough opening with low-expansion closed-cell foam, they have created a direct cold path into your home. This is a violation of basic building science. To get them to fix this, ask for a thermal imaging report. A high-quality window should show a uniform temperature across the glass. If you see dark blue streaks at the edges, the support team failed to ensure a continuous air barrier. They must own this mistake because it affects the guaranteed energy performance of the product.

The Low-E Coating Deception
Sometimes the mistake isn’t in the labor, but in the material selection. In cold climates, we want the Low-E coating on Surface #3. This reflects the long-wave infrared radiation (your furnace heat) back into the room. If a provider accidentally ordered units with the coating on Surface #2, which is designed for hot climates like Phoenix to reflect solar heat out, your house will feel freezing even with the heat cranked up. You can test this yourself with a simple heat lamp or by looking at the reflection of a match flame. If the third reflection is a different color, they have installed the wrong glass for your climate zone. This is a massive error that local experts should never make, and it is grounds for a total product replacement under their service agreement.
How to Demand Rectification
To get results, stop talking to the sales representative and start talking to the project manager. Use the technical terms they fear. Mention the rough opening tolerances and the flashing tape adhesion. Explain that you know the difference between a muntin and a glazing bead. When you speak the language of the trade, they realize they cannot distract you with jargon. Demand a line-by-line comparison of your installation against the manufacturer’s published instructions. If they deviated, the warranty is void, and the provider is legally and ethically responsible for the remediation.
